1. Preliminary Assembly with Priest
The preliminary assembly with a parish priest constitutes the foundational step within the technique of getting ready for marriage inside the Catholic Church. This encounter serves because the formal graduation of the method, setting in movement a sequence of necessities and procedures that should be fulfilled previous to the celebration of the sacrament. Failure to schedule and full this preliminary session successfully prevents additional progress towards marriage inside the Church. This primary assembly permits the priest to establish the {couples} understanding of Catholic marriage and description subsequent steps. For instance, a pair meaning to marry in a selected parish shall be directed to fulfill with the assigned priest or deacon to start this course of.
This assembly additionally gives a possibility for the priest to assemble preliminary data relating to the couple’s background, religion formation, and intentions for marriage. He’ll usually inquire about their baptismal standing, earlier marital historical past (if any), and their understanding of the Church’s teachings on the character of marriage. Within the occasion that both social gathering has been beforehand married, the priest will provoke the method of investigating the validity of the prior union, doubtlessly requiring canonical procedures similar to a proper annulment course of. This early evaluation is essential in figuring out any potential impediments to a sound Catholic marriage. Contemplate the situation the place one associate shouldn’t be Catholic; the priest will clarify the necessities for the Catholic associate to boost their kids within the Catholic religion.

3. Freedom to Marry Documentation
Ecclesiastical regulation mandates that people searching for to enter into matrimony inside the Catholic Church should show their freedom to marry. This requirement necessitates the supply of particular documentation, rigorously assessed to make sure the validity of the meant union, and represents an indispensable prerequisite for the method.
-
Baptismal Certificates
A not too long ago issued baptismal certificates serves as major proof of the person’s non secular affiliation and sacramental standing. It confirms that the individual has been baptized, a elementary requirement for Catholic marriage. The certificates usually contains annotations relating to different sacraments acquired, which can affect the evaluation of freedom to marry. As an example, if the certificates signifies a previous marriage acknowledged by the Church, additional investigation and doubtlessly a proper annulment course of could be essential. Its absence or discrepancies can delay or impede the wedding course of.
-
Pre-Nuptial Inquiry Types
These kinds, accomplished independently by the bride and groom and sometimes supplemented by testimony from witnesses, elicit data relating to potential impediments to marriage. Questions deal with prior marital historical past, familial relationships, and adherence to canonical norms. The responses present the priest or deacon with a complete overview of every particular person’s circumstances, permitting for the identification of any canonical irregularities or potential obstacles. False or deceptive data supplied on these kinds can invalidate the wedding.
-
Affidavits of Freedom to Marry
In conditions the place definitive documentary proof is missing, affidavits from credible witnesses could also be required. These affidavits, sworn below oath, attest to the person’s freedom from prior marital bonds and their eligibility to enter into marriage. That is notably related in circumstances the place baptismal data are unavailable or incomplete. The acceptance of affidavits is contingent upon the credibility of the witnesses and their familiarity with the person’s private historical past.
-
Dispensation Documentation (if relevant)
Conditions come up the place canonical impediments exist, necessitating a proper dispensation from Church authority. Frequent examples embody disparity of cult (marriage between a Catholic and a non-baptized individual) or consanguinity (blood relationship). The documentation supporting the request for dispensation should be completely ready and submitted to the suitable ecclesiastical tribunal. The granting of a dispensation shouldn’t be computerized and is topic to cautious overview and approval by Church officers. With out the required dispensation, the wedding can’t be validly celebrated inside the Catholic Church.

4. Canonical Interviews
Canonical interviews symbolize a essential step within the Catholic Church’s technique of assessing a pair’s readiness and eligibility for sacramental marriage. These interviews, performed by a priest or deacon, serve to establish the couple’s understanding of the character of marriage, their free consent, and the absence of any impediments to a sound union. The knowledge gathered throughout these interviews instantly influences the Church’s determination relating to the couple’s capability to get married in a Catholic church.
-
Ascertaining Freedom of Consent
A major goal of the canonical interview is to confirm that each people are getting into into marriage freely and with out coercion. The priest or deacon will inquire about potential strain from members of the family, monetary concerns, or different exterior elements which may compromise the voluntary nature of their consent. For instance, if one associate expresses reservations or hesitations through the interview, the priest will delve deeper to make sure that these considerations are addressed adequately. This factor reinforces the precept {that a} legitimate Catholic marriage requires the complete and unreserved consent of each events.
-
Figuring out Understanding of Marital Obligations
The interviews assess the couple’s comprehension of the important properties of Catholic marriage: unity, indissolubility, and openness to procreation. The priest will discover their understanding of those ideas, probing their intentions relating to constancy, permanence, and the potential for having kids. Contemplate a situation the place one associate expresses a perception that divorce is an appropriate choice within the occasion of marital difficulties; this might necessitate additional catechesis and clarification relating to the Church’s instructing on the indissolubility of marriage. This aspect ensures a shared understanding of the lifelong dedication inherent in Catholic matrimony.
-
Figuring out Potential Impediments
Canonical regulation outlines particular impediments that may invalidate a wedding, similar to prior current marital bonds, consanguinity (shut blood relationship), or disparity of cult (marriage between a Catholic and a non-baptized individual). The interviews serve to establish any such impediments that could be current. As an example, if one associate discloses a earlier marriage not acknowledged by the Church, the priest will provoke the method of investigating the validity of the prior union. Addressing these potential impediments is essential for guaranteeing the validity of the sacramental marriage.

7. The Marriage ceremony Ceremony Itself
The marriage ceremony represents the fruits of your complete preparation course of, embodying the general public and sacramental expression of consent that establishes the marital bond inside the Catholic Church. It’s the central occasion that confers the sacrament of matrimony, and its correct execution is paramount to the validity of the wedding.
-
Entrance Procession and Introductory Rites
The ceremony commences with the doorway procession, signifying the couple’s entrance into the sacred house and their transition into a brand new state of life. The procession usually contains the priest or deacon, the marriage social gathering, and eventually the bride. Introductory rites, such because the greeting and opening prayer, set the tone for the ceremony and invoke God’s blessing upon the couple. As an example, the selection of processional music ought to replicate the solemnity of the event. Errors or omissions throughout these introductory parts, whereas not invalidating the wedding, can detract from the reverential ambiance.
-
Liturgy of the Phrase
The Liturgy of the Phrase facilities across the readings from Scripture, chosen in session with the priest or deacon, that spotlight the which means of affection, dedication, and marriage inside the Christian custom. A homily, delivered by the priest or deacon, expounds upon these readings and their relevance to the couple’s lives. The couple’s attentiveness to the readings and the homily demonstrates their understanding of the religious basis of their marriage. Ignoring or disrupting the readings undermines the liturgical deal with divine steering and knowledge.
-
Change of Vows
The trade of vows constitutes the important factor of the marriage ceremony, whereby the couple publicly declares their free and unconditional consent to enter into marriage. The particular wording of the vows is prescribed by the Church, emphasizing lifelong dedication, constancy, and openness to kids. Any deviation from the prescribed vows or any indication of reservations or circumstances connected to the consent can render the wedding invalid. The clear and unambiguous trade of vows, witnessed by the priest or deacon and the assembled congregation, solidifies the marital bond.
-
Liturgy of the Eucharist (Optionally available) and Concluding Rites
If the marriage happens inside the context of a Mass, the Liturgy of the Eucharist follows the trade of vows. The couple and the congregation take part within the providing of the Eucharist, symbolizing their union with Christ and their reception of grace to reside out their marital dedication. The concluding rites, together with the ultimate blessing and the dismissal, mark the top of the ceremony and the couple’s departure as husband and spouse. Regularly Requested Questions
This part addresses widespread inquiries relating to the method of getting ready for and celebrating marriage inside the Catholic Church. It goals to offer readability on important necessities and deal with potential misconceptions.
Query 1: Is premarital counseling obligatory for Catholic weddings?
Sure, premarital counseling, typically referred to as Pre-Cana, is often a compulsory element of preparation. The particular format and period might fluctuate by diocese, however its objective is to equip {couples} with the instruments and understanding essential for a profitable and lasting marriage.
Query 2: What documentation is required to show freedom to marry?
Usually, a not too long ago issued baptismal certificates is required from each events. If both particular person was beforehand married, documentation demonstrating the dissolution of the prior marriage by dying or annulment is important. Additional documentation could also be requested by the priest or deacon.
Query 3: What if one associate shouldn’t be Catholic?
Marriage between a Catholic and a non-Catholic is permissible, however requires a dispensation from canonical type. The Catholic social gathering should additionally promise to do all of their energy to boost any kids within the Catholic religion. The particular necessities and implications shall be mentioned with the priest through the preliminary conferences.
Query 4: What’s an annulment, and when is it required?
An annulment, formally often called a declaration of nullity, is a judgment by the Church {that a} prior marriage was not validly entered into on account of some obstacle or defect of consent. An annulment is required if both social gathering has been beforehand married and the Church acknowledges the prior union as binding.
Query 5: Can a Catholic marriage ceremony happen outdoors of a church constructing?
Typically, Catholic weddings are celebrated inside a church constructing. Exceptions could also be granted in sure circumstances with the permission of the bishop. Seek the advice of with the native parish priest for steering on particular circumstances.
Query 6: How far upfront ought to a pair start planning their Catholic marriage ceremony?
It is suggested that {couples} start the wedding preparation course of a minimum of six months to a yr previous to their desired marriage ceremony date. This permits ample time to finish all essential necessities, together with premarital counseling and documentation gathering.
